Machining Services

Cylinder block machining

Machining Services Cost Estimates
Cylinder block machining The cost of cylinder block machining for a 355 stroker engine can vary depending on the specific services required. On average, professional machining services can range from $500 to $1000.

Cylinder head machining

Machining Services Cost Estimates
Cylinder head machining The cost of cylinder head machining for a 355 stroker engine can also vary depending on the extent of work needed. Typically, this service can cost anywhere from $200 to $600.

Balancing and blueprinting the engine

Machining Services Cost Estimates
Balancing and blueprinting To balance and blueprint a 355 stroker engine, you can expect to pay around $800 to $1500. This process ensures optimal performance and reliability.

Cost estimates for machining services

Machining Services Cost Estimates
Total machining services When considering the machining services needed for a 355 stroker engine, the total cost can range from $1500 to $3100, depending on the specific requirements and sources chosen.

Labor Costs

The labor costs for building a 355 stroker engine can vary depending on the engine builder and their expertise. However, on average, engine builders charge around $60 to $100 per hour for labor. The estimated number of hours needed for assembly can range from 15 to 25 hours, depending on the complexity of the build and any additional modifications required.

In addition to the labor costs, there may be additional costs for tuning and testing the engine once it has been assembled. This can include dyno tuning to optimize performance and ensure everything is running smoothly. The tuning and testing costs can vary but typically range from $500 to $1000.

When building a 355 stroker engine, it’s important to factor in both the labor costs and any additional costs for tuning and testing. This will give you a better understanding of the total investment needed to build a high-performance engine.
